A Closer Look at the Beige Rose Colorway:
The Nike Air Max 95 41 Beige Rose boasts a muted, earthy palette that lends itself to versatility. Unlike bolder, more vibrant colorways, this iteration emphasizes understated elegance. The "Beige Rose" moniker accurately describes the color scheme. Various shades of beige, from a creamy off-white to a deeper, more taupe-like tone, dominate the shoe's upper. These beige hues are then subtly accented with hints of rose, a pale blush pink that adds a touch of femininity without overpowering the overall neutral aesthetic. This delicate pink is often found on the Air Max unit, the eyelets, or as subtle detailing on the layered panels.
The use of suede and mesh materials further enhances the shoe's texture and visual interest. The suede overlays, in varying shades of beige, provide a premium feel and contribute to the shoe's durability. The mesh underlays, often in a lighter beige, offer breathability, crucial for comfort during warmer months. This combination of materials creates a sophisticated contrast, playing with light and shadow to give the shoe depth and dimension. The visible Air Max units, usually a translucent off-white or a pale pink, complete the design, offering both comfort and a visually striking element. The overall effect is one of understated luxury, a shoe that speaks volumes without shouting.
The Legacy of the Nike Air Max 95:
To fully appreciate the Nike Air Max 95 41 Beige Rose, one must understand the historical significance of the Air Max 95 itself. Designed by Sergio Lozano, the Air Max 95 was a revolutionary shoe for its time. Its groundbreaking design, inspired by the human anatomy – the midsole representing the spine, the side panels the ribs, and the laces the shoelaces – was a bold departure from previous sneaker designs. This innovative approach, coupled with the introduction of visible Air units in the heel *and* forefoot, set a new standard for both comfort and aesthetic appeal.
The Air Max 95's immediate success cemented its place in sneaker history. It quickly became a cultural icon, transcending its original athletic purpose to become a staple of streetwear and fashion. Its popularity continues to this day, with countless collaborations, re-releases, and new colorways keeping the silhouette fresh and relevant. The original release in 1995, often featuring bold color combinations and gradient effects, created a strong visual identity that has been revisited and reinterpreted countless times.
